Participation: Advancing IT Professionals in the UK
Becoming a member of the BCS, The Chartered Institute for IT, offers many benefits to skilled computing professionals in the United Kingdom. Members gain access to a active community of like-minded individuals, facilitating networking and cooperation. The BCS provides crucial resources such as technical advice, professional development opportunities, and representation for the computing profession.
Through its comprehensive range of events, conferences, and publications, the BCS stays at the forefront of industry developments. Membership also improves your recognition within the field and facilitates access to fulfilling career possibilities.

IEEE, the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ers, is renowned for its contributions to computer engineering and related fields. BCS, the British Computer Society, focuses on computing practitioners and fosters a collaborative community. ACM, the Association for Computing Machinery, is a global authority in computer science research and education.
